M17 and Taurus A: 3.4-mm Contour Maps and Integrated Fluxes.
Abstract
Contour maps at 3.4-mm of M17 (the Omega Nebula) and Tau A (the Crab Nebula) yield total integrated fluxes of 300 (+50, -40) and 215 (+44, -34) x 10 to the minus 26th power w/sqm-Hz, respectively. These results are in agreement with the values predicted by extrapolating data obtained at longer wavelengths. The M17 result is consistent with a thermal origin for the radiation. The low signal-to-noise ratio results reported by others, which indicated anomalously high total fluxes for Tau A at millimeter wavelengths, are not confirmed. The 3.4-mm maps are consistent with maps made at longer wavelengths. (Author)
